Pastor Mike asked me to share a little bit about Haven today and that's where I've been working for the last 6.5 years. It's a Christian radio program and some of you may remember a name Haven of Rest.
It began in 1934, right in Los Angeles and has continued to this day. It's known as Haven today. but it is in, in March we'll be celebrating our eighty-fifth anniversary as a continuous daily radio program and there aren't many just radio programs in general that have that legacy, let alone a Christian one.
